  • Patent number: 6011457
    Abstract: An engine igniting coil device directly attachable to an igniting plug, wherein both primary and secondary coil bobbins have flangeless ends, the secondary coil bobbin has inwardly protruding ribs for coaxially supporting the flangeless end of the primary coil bobbin mounted therein and the secondary coil bobbin also has protrusions formed at its external wall apart from a high-voltage terminal of the secondary coil wound thereon and is coaxially mounted in a coil case by abutting its protrusions on an inner wall thereof, thus eliminating the possibility of damaging the bobbins by a large thermal stress produced in solidified insulating resin in a coil case by a differential thermal shrinkage in an axial direction and preventing a leakage current from a high-voltage side of the secondary coil bobbin to the coil case through a flange-like connection.
    Type: Grant
    Filed: August 28, 1997
    Date of Patent: January 4, 2000
    Assignee: Toyo Denso Kabushiki Kaisha
    Inventors: Makoto Sakamaki, Toshiyuki Shinozawa, Yoshiharu Saito
  • Patent number: 6005464
    Abstract: An engine igniting coil device adapted to be mounted in a cylindrical bore of an engine and directly connected with an ignition plug therein has a coil case containing an igniting coil assembly and made of conductive magnetic material which is held at the ground potential level, thus preventing a decrease of output factor of the igniting coil of produced magnetic flux when spreading about and passing through a cylinder head of the engine and eliminating the possibility of leakage discharge from a high-voltage portion of the igniting coil assembly to the coil case and the cylinder head.
    Type: Grant
    Filed: August 28, 1997
    Date of Patent: December 21, 1999
    Assignee: Toyo Denso Kabushiki Kasiha
    Inventors: Makoto Sakamaki, Toshiyuki Shinozawa, Yoshiharu Saito
  • Patent number: 5929736
    Abstract: In an engine igniting coil device comprising an ignition coil assembly potted integrally in a coil case by injecting melted insulating resin, a secondary coil is formed on a coil bobbin by bank winding an element wire in layers of wire turns one over another at a certain bank angle in an axial direction on the bobbin and by slope-winding of layers on the end portion of the bobbin by tapering the coil (by reducing the number of layers therein) in the winding direction. This allows setting a dielectric strength of interlayer insulation of the secondary coil according to a potential distribution therebetween, which is secured by forming an insulation resin layer of a reduced thickness between the coil case and the secondary coil of the secondary coil bobbin, thus realizing a compact engine-igniting coil device.
    Type: Grant
    Filed: August 28, 1997
    Date of Patent: July 27, 1999
    Assignee: Toyo Denso Kabushiki Kaisha
    Inventors: Makoto Sakamaki, Toshiyuki Shinozawa, Yoshiharu Saito
  • Patent number: 5870012
    Abstract: An engine ignition coil device which comprises a coil case composed of a first cylindrical case and a second case having a small tubular hole in its center portion and an upper external shoulder at its open end fitted in an open end of the first case to form a closed end of the coil case and an internal unit assembled from a primary side coil bobbin, a secondary-side coil bobbin having a high-voltage terminal holder projecting from a center of its end flange portion, a rod-shaped core, and a high-voltage terminal attached to the high-voltage terminal holder and having a contact for electrically connecting an ignition plug thereto. The internal assembly is mounted in the coil case by inserting the high-voltage terminal holder in the small tubular hole of the secondary case with a tip of the contact projected outwardly therefrom and formed integrally with the coil case by injecting melted insulating resin into the coil case.
    Type: Grant
    Filed: December 19, 1996
    Date of Patent: February 9, 1999
    Assignee: Toyo Denso Kabushiki Kaisha
    Inventors: Makoto Sakamaki, Toshiyuki Shinozawa
  • Patent number: 5767758
    Abstract: A plug cap incorporated type ignition coil is provided with a primary coil 20 and a secondary coil 30 inserted in a case 10. After a cushion member 80, a magnet 82, and then a core 40 are inserted in order in a primary coil bobbin 22 of a generally cylindrical bottomed shape, the case 10 is filled with potting resin 70. There is interposed a bottom wall portion of the primary coil bobbin 22 between one end 42 of the core 40 and the potting resin 70. Accordingly, even though stress resulting from the difference in thermal shrinkage between the core 40, the primary coil bobbin 22 and the potting resin 70 is caused, the stress is absorbed by elasticity of the primary coil bobbin 22 and as a result, the potting resin 70 is hard to cause a crack. Also, even though the core is affected by the thermal shrinkage, the magnet 82 is hard to destroy.
    Type: Grant
    Filed: September 12, 1995
    Date of Patent: June 16, 1998
    Assignee: Toyodenso Kabushiki Kaisha
    Inventor: Makoto Sakamaki
  • Patent number: 5444427
    Abstract: An engine igniting coil device comprising a coil case with a plurality of coil units disposed therein and integrally potted with insulating resin, which is featured by provision with a coil cover that fits in the coil case and can mount therein high-voltage and low-voltage terminal sockets for the coil units, allowing the assembly of the electrical connections of the coil units in optimal conditions.
    Type: Grant
    Filed: September 20, 1993
    Date of Patent: August 22, 1995
    Assignee: Toyo Denso Kabushiki Kaisha
    Inventors: Yasuhiko Ida, Makoto Sakamaki
  • Patent number: 5416459
    Abstract: An engine igniting coil device wherein an I-type core fitted in a hollow portion of a primary coil bobbin and a U-type core are arranged to oppose at their end faces, each other at a specified gap therebetween to form a closed magnetic circuit. The primary coil bobbin with the I-type core has a core holding portion integrally formed thereon for attaching thereto an end portion of the U-type core and the core holding portion also serves as an anti-cracking cover. This cover can accurately determine the positions of both cores and can effectively prevent initiation of cracking in the potting resin injected and cured in the coil case.
    Type: Grant
    Filed: September 20, 1993
    Date of Patent: May 16, 1995
    Assignee: Toyo Denso Kabushiki Kaisha
    Inventors: Yasuhiko Ida, Makoto Sakamaki
